Morgan Stanley

Senior Research Software Engineer ( AWS/Python) - Parametric

Remote Seattle, WA
USD 110k - 225k
SQL Redis Kafka Python Streaming Docker Terraform Git AWS
Description

ABOUT MORGAN STANLEY
Morgan Stanley is a leading global financial services firm providing a wide range of investment banking, securities, wealth management and investment management services. With offices in more than 41 countries, the Firm's employees serve clients worldwide including corporations, governments, institutions and individuals. For further information about Morgan Stanley, please visit www.morganstanley.com.

ABOUT PARAMETRIC
Parametric is part of Morgan Stanley Investment Management, the asset management division of Morgan Stanley. We partner with advisors, institutions, and consultants to build portfolios focused on what's important to them and their clients. A leader in custom solutions for more than 30 years, we help investors access efficient market exposures, solve implementation challenges, and design multi-asset portfolios that respond to their evolving needs. We also offer systematic alpha and alternative strategies to complement clients' core holdings.

This role is part of Parametric's hybrid working model, which includes working in the office 2-3 days a week and choosing to work remotely or in the office the remaining days of the week.


ABOUT THE TEAM
The Quantitative Development team supports Portfolio Management and Research with equity models and tools that are used to guide our investment process. The Senior Research Software Engineer will assist in migrating these tools and models to a cloud native infrastructure

As part of the Quantitative Development team, the Senior Research Software Engineer will be responsible for the design/architecture and implementation of various cloud native services primarily focused on AWS based infrastructure and tooling.


PRIMARY RESPONSIBILITIES
- Work closely with the business unit and other team members to understand and document requirements
- Design and develop integration solutions with 3rd party data providers and systems
- Share experience, knowledge, and ideas to the team to improve processes and productivity
- Create unit/integration/functional tests
- Follow our development process and guidelines
- Conduct code reviews of other developers, merge-request reviews
- Follow technology trends/tools and recommend improvements to our technology when appropriate
- Act as the security expert for the development team by advocating for secure coding practices and implementing security related features
- Responsible for researching and implementing software development initiatives that are cross functional and may be passed off to other groups later

JOB REQUIREMENTS
- 5+ years of experience developing cloud native applications
- Python design and development experience is a plus
- Ability to work well in a highly social and collaborative environment
- Strong knowledge of various AWS cloud services including Batch, Lambda, EKS,
   Fargate
- In depth experience with various message streaming technologies like Kafka
- Solid understanding of Docker and container orchestration
- IaaS familiarity, working knowledge of Terraform
- Familiarity with version control systems such as GIT or SVN
- Working experience with agile development
- Familiarity with continuous integration and build tools
- Working knowledge of SQL and NoSQL databases, as well as cache solutions such
  as Redis.
- Proven track record of becoming a subject matter expert in areas related to current
  assignments
- Effective communication skills with business users and other developers


Parametric believes each member of our organization makes a significant contribution to our success. That contribution should not be limited by the assigned responsibilities. Therefore, this job description is designed to outline primary duties and qualifications. It is our expectation that every member of our team will offer his/her/their services wherever and whenever necessary to ensure the success of our client services.

Salary range for the position:  $110,000 - $225,000/Yr. The successful candidate may be eligible for an annual discretionary incentive compensation award. The successful candidate may be eligible to participate in the relevant business unit’s incentive compensation plan, which also may include a discretionary bonus component. Morgan Stanley offers a full spectrum of benefits, including Medical, Prescription Drug, Dental, Vision, Health Savings Account, Dependent Day Care Savings Account, Life Insurance, Disability and Other Insurance Plans, Paid Time Off (including Sick Leave consistent with state and local law, Parental Leave and 20  Vacation Days annually), 10 Paid Holidays, 401(k), and Short/Long Term Disability, in addition to other special perks reserved for our employees. Please visit mybenefits.morganstanley.com to learn more about our benefit offerings.


Morgan Stanley's goal is to build and maintain a workforce that is diverse in experience and background but uniform in reflecting our standards of integrity and excellence. Consequently, our recruiting efforts reflect our desire to attract and retain the best and brightest from all talent pools. We want to be the first choice for prospective employees. It is the policy of the Firm to ensure equal employment opportunity without discrimination or harassment on the basis of race, color, religion, creed, age, sex, sex stereotype, gender, gender identity or expression, transgender, sexual orientation, national origin, citizenship, disability, marital and civil partnership/union status, pregnancy, veteran or military service status, genetic information, or any other characteristic protected by law. Morgan Stanley is an equal opportunity employer committed to diversifying its workforce (M/F/Disability/Vet).

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

50,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 241 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

Cancel anytime / Money-back guarantee

Wall of love from fellow engineers